diff options
author | Maxim Polishchuck | 2015-10-10 19:44:23 +0300 |
---|---|---|
committer | Maxim Polishchuck | 2015-10-10 19:44:23 +0300 |
commit | 3c05500627e1d7e85680ce7fcbd7ffaefeadd0a9 (patch) | |
tree | 66ba7c5ac5787e1d2fcf59d32a24c18797e66fde | |
download | aur-3c05500627e1d7e85680ce7fcbd7ffaefeadd0a9.tar.gz |
Initial commit
-rw-r--r-- | .SRCINFO | 26 | ||||
-rw-r--r-- | PKGBUILD | 42 |
2 files changed, 68 insertions, 0 deletions
diff --git a/.SRCINFO b/.SRCINFO new file mode 100644 index 000000000000..aa2d41ca66b4 --- /dev/null +++ b/.SRCINFO @@ -0,0 +1,26 @@ +pkgbase = perl-carton + pkgdesc = Perl module dependency manager (aka Bundler for Perl) + pkgver = 1.0.12 + pkgrel = 2 + url = http://search.cpan.org/~miyagawa/Carton-v1.0.12/ + arch = any + license = GPL + license = PerlArtistic + makedepends = perl-module-build + depends = perl-cpan-meta + depends = perl-exception-class + depends = perl-file-pushd + depends = perl-json + depends = perl-try-tiny + depends = perl-moo + depends = perl-path-tiny + depends = perl-module-cpanfile + depends = perl-module-reader + depends = cpanminus + depends = perl-app-fatpacker>=0.009018 + options = !emptydirs + source = http://search.cpan.org/CPAN/authors/id/M/MI/MIYAGAWA/Carton-v1.0.12.tar.gz + md5sums = c3b753736f62e7094bf1585244b1f4dd + +pkgname = perl-carton + diff --git a/PKGBUILD b/PKGBUILD new file mode 100644 index 000000000000..1f63aae647d9 --- /dev/null +++ b/PKGBUILD @@ -0,0 +1,42 @@ +# Maintainer: Maxim Polishchuck <mpolishchuck@gmail.com> +# Contributor: Andy Weidenbaum <archbaum@gmail.com> + +_perlmod=Carton +pkgname=perl-carton +pkgver=1.0.12 +pkgrel=2 +pkgdesc='Perl module dependency manager (aka Bundler for Perl)' +arch=('any') +url="http://search.cpan.org/~miyagawa/$_perlmod-v$pkgver/" +license=('GPL' 'PerlArtistic') +depends=( + 'perl-cpan-meta' + 'perl-exception-class' + 'perl-file-pushd' + 'perl-json' + 'perl-try-tiny' + 'perl-moo' + 'perl-path-tiny' + 'perl-module-cpanfile' + 'perl-module-reader' + 'cpanminus' + 'perl-app-fatpacker>=0.009018' +) +makedepends=('perl-module-build') +options=('!emptydirs') +source=("http://search.cpan.org/CPAN/authors/id/M/MI/MIYAGAWA/$_perlmod-v$pkgver.tar.gz") +md5sums=('c3b753736f62e7094bf1585244b1f4dd') + +build() { + cd "$srcdir/$_perlmod-v$pkgver" + unset PERL5LIB PERL_MM_OPT PERL_MB_OPT PERL_LOCAL_LIB_ROOT + export PERL_MM_USE_DEFAULT=1 MODULEBUILDRC=/dev/null + /usr/bin/perl Build.PL + ./Build +} + +package() { + cd "$srcdir/$_perlmod-v$pkgver" + unset PERL5LIB PERL_MM_OPT PERL_MB_OPT PERL_LOCAL_LIB_ROOT + ./Build install installdirs=vendor destdir="$pkgdir" +} |